dated May 3, 1957 : A counter-challenge

The Kerala Chief Minister, Mr. E.M.S. Nambudiripad, threw a counter-challenge to the Union Finance Minister, Mr. T.T. Krishnamachari, that if the Congress Government could solve the unemployment problem in the country within a specified period, he would become a "Congressman." Mr. Krishnamachari had said at a meeting in Madras that if the Communist Government in Kerala could find a solution to the problem of "educated unemployment," he would become a Communist. Referring to this, Mr. Nambudiripad said in Ernakulam that nothing could be solved by indulging in "demagogic challenges."
